The Business Risk Behind Slow Website Infrastructure
Slow website infrastructure is often treated as a technical inconvenience.
A page takes longer to load, the WordPress dashboard occasionally becomes unresponsive or a form needs several seconds to submit. These issues may seem minor because the website remains online.
For a business, however, infrastructure performance affects much more than page speed.
It can influence customer trust, marketing efficiency, employee productivity, sales reliability and the ability to grow. When the underlying hosting environment cannot support the website consistently, technical limitations become business risks.
The damage is rarely caused by one dramatic failure. It usually appears through many small losses that accumulate over time.
Infrastructure Supports Every Website Action
Website infrastructure includes the hosting server, database, storage, networking and the resources available to process requests.
These systems support actions such as:
opening pages;
loading images;
searching the website;
submitting forms;
logging into accounts;
updating baskets;
processing payments;
creating orders;
running backups;
publishing content.
Visitors do not see these components separately. They experience one website.
When infrastructure performs well, customers can focus on the product, service or information. When it performs poorly, waiting and uncertainty become part of the customer journey.
Slow Performance Creates Uncertainty
A slow page does more than delay access to information.
It can make visitors question whether:
the website is still working;
their click was registered;
the business is reliable;
a form was submitted;
a payment is being processed;
they should try the action again.
This uncertainty becomes more serious as the visitor moves closer to a commercial action.
A delay on an article may cause someone to leave. A delay after a form submission can make a potential customer unsure whether the enquiry was received. A delay during checkout can create concern about duplicate orders or payments.
Infrastructure therefore affects confidence, not only speed.
Lost Opportunities Are Difficult to See
A website outage creates a visible incident. The business knows that customers could not access the site during a specific period.
Slow infrastructure is more difficult to measure.
The website may continue receiving traffic and generating some conversions. However, it can also quietly lose:
visitors who return to search results;
leads who abandon slow forms;
shoppers who leave product pages;
customers who stop during checkout;
mobile users on weaker connections;
repeat visitors who remember the poor experience.
These people rarely contact the business to explain why they left.
The opportunity disappears without creating a support ticket or obvious error message.
This makes slow infrastructure easy to underestimate.
Marketing Spend Becomes Less Efficient
Businesses invest in attracting visitors through:
search engine optimisation;
paid advertising;
social media;
email marketing;
digital PR;
partnerships;
content marketing.
The cost is paid before the visitor begins using the website.
If infrastructure creates delays after the click, part of that investment loses value. The advert or article may attract the right person, but the website fails to support the next step.
For example, a paid campaign may deliver relevant traffic while the landing page becomes slow under load. The campaign then appears to have weak conversion performance.
The team may respond by changing the advert, audience or offer when infrastructure is contributing to the result.
Slow hosting can therefore distort marketing decisions as well as reduce campaign returns.
Content Cannot Deliver Its Full Value
Content marketing is intended to attract attention, build trust and guide visitors towards another page or action.
Infrastructure limitations can interrupt this path.
A visitor may open a useful article but leave before related content loads. They may click a service link and encounter a slower dynamic page. A download form may fail after they have already decided to provide their details.

The problem is not necessarily the content itself. The business may have invested in excellent writing, research and design while the delivery environment reduces the number of people who benefit from it.
Lead Generation Becomes Less Reliable
Commercial websites often depend on forms.
These may include:
contact requests;
quote forms;
bookings;
newsletter signups;
consultation requests;
file uploads;
product demonstrations.
Submitting a form requires dynamic server processing. The website may need to validate fields, run security checks, store the information, send emails and connect to a CRM.
When server resources are limited, form processing may become slow or unreliable.
A visitor may click the submit button and see no clear response. They may leave, try again or create a duplicate request.
The business may never know that a potential lead tried to make contact.
This turns infrastructure performance into a direct sales risk.
Ecommerce Risk Appears Closest to Revenue
Online stores rely heavily on dynamic activity.
Customers search products, choose variations, update baskets, apply coupons, calculate delivery and communicate with payment gateways.
These actions require PHP processing, database activity and external requests.
When infrastructure becomes slow, the effect may include:
delayed product updates;
unresponsive Add to Cart buttons;
slow basket changes;
checkout queues;
payment uncertainty;
incomplete orders;
failed stock updates.
The closer the delay occurs to payment, the greater the commercial risk.
A customer who has already selected a product and entered their details has demonstrated strong buying intent. Losing that customer because the website cannot respond consistently is more costly than losing a casual visitor.
Inconsistent Performance Damages Trust
Some websites are not permanently slow. They become slow at particular times.
Performance may change because of:
traffic spikes;
shared-server activity;
backups;
security scans;
database load;
limited PHP workers;
Disk I/O restrictions;
resource throttling.
Inconsistency can be especially damaging because the website becomes unpredictable.
A visitor may open the homepage quickly but experience a delay on the contact page. A returning customer may remember that checkout worked previously and become concerned when it is slow today.
The business cannot control which visitor encounters the weak period.
Important customers, journalists, partners or potential clients may see the website at its worst.
Staff Productivity Is Also Affected
Slow infrastructure creates internal costs.
Employees may spend more time waiting to:
open the WordPress dashboard;
edit content;
upload images;
update products;
process orders;
generate reports;
manage customers;
install updates;
create backups.
A delay of several seconds may seem minor, but it can occur dozens of times throughout the working day.
Technical teams may also spend time investigating intermittent problems, clearing caches, restarting processes or trying to optimise around hosting restrictions.
The hosting bill remains low, but the business pays through labour and reduced productivity.
Development Becomes More Expensive
When infrastructure is weak, developers may repeatedly attempt to improve performance at the application level.
Useful work may include:
compressing images;
reducing scripts;
removing plugins;
optimising database queries;
configuring caching;
rescheduling background jobs.
These improvements should still be made.
However, development becomes inefficient when every change is designed to keep the website just below a hard resource ceiling.
The team may spend many hours saving small amounts of processing while the hosting plan remains fundamentally unsuitable for the workload.
At that point, avoiding an infrastructure upgrade can cost more than the upgrade itself.
Growth Makes the Risk Larger
A small website may operate successfully on basic hosting.
As the business grows, the website may add:
more visitors;
more content;
more plugins;
more customer accounts;
more integrations;
more products;
more orders;
larger backups;
heavier scheduled tasks.
The workload changes even if the hosting plan does not.
A website that was stable during its first year may become unreliable after several stages of growth.
Infrastructure should therefore be reviewed regularly rather than only after a serious incident.
Campaigns Can Expose Hidden Limits
Marketing campaigns concentrate traffic and customer activity into shorter periods.
A website may work normally during an ordinary week but become slow immediately after:
an email send;
a product launch;
a promotion;
a social media mention;
a successful advert;
press coverage.
The campaign itself may be performing well. The traffic increase simply exposes resource limitations that were already present.
This creates a frustrating outcome: the business invests in generating demand, then infrastructure prevents it from capturing the full value of that demand.
Operational Tasks Can Compete With Customers
Websites run important background processes.
These include:
backups;
security scans;
imports;
inventory synchronisation;
image optimisation;
scheduled emails;
database maintenance.
These tasks use the same CPU, memory, database and storage resources that serve visitors.
On an infrastructure environment with limited capacity, a large backup or scan can slow the public website.
The business may not recognise the relationship because the background task is invisible to customers.
Scheduling can reduce the conflict, but a growing website still needs enough capacity to support routine operations safely.
Downtime Is Not the Only Infrastructure Failure
Businesses often evaluate hosting mainly through uptime.
Uptime is important, but it does not show the complete experience.
A website can be technically available while:
pages take several seconds to respond;
forms time out;
the dashboard is difficult to use;
checkout requests wait in queues;
database queries become slow;
resource limits are repeatedly reached.
From the hosting provider’s perspective, the server may be online. From the customer’s perspective, the website may still be unreliable.
Infrastructure quality should therefore be evaluated through performance consistency as well as uptime.
Cheap Hosting Can Create Expensive Consequences
A low monthly price is easy to measure.
The indirect costs of weak infrastructure are harder to calculate because they are spread across many areas:
lower conversion rates;
wasted advertising traffic;
lost leads;
abandoned purchases;
employee waiting time;
repeated developer work;
campaign instability;
weaker customer trust.

More expensive hosting is not automatically better. The goal is to choose infrastructure that matches the importance and workload of the website.
Warning Signs of Infrastructure Risk
Website owners should investigate when several of these signs appear:
pages slow down during busy periods;
forms respond inconsistently;
the dashboard is frequently sluggish;
backups affect frontend performance;
resource-limit warnings are common;
marketing campaigns cause instability;
optimisation produces only temporary improvements;
customers report delays or failed actions;
hosting support repeatedly recommends reducing activity;
the website cannot scale without a complicated migration.
One issue may have a simple cause. A repeated pattern across several areas suggests a broader infrastructure problem.
Reducing the Business Risk
A practical infrastructure review should include:
testing the most commercially important pages;
checking form, basket and checkout actions;
reviewing CPU, memory and PHP worker usage;
examining database and Disk I/O performance;
identifying heavy background jobs;
testing under realistic concurrent traffic;
reviewing backup and recovery procedures;
confirming upgrade and scaling options.
The review should focus on how infrastructure supports business activity, not only technical benchmarks.
A slightly faster score is useful. Reliable lead generation, checkout and campaign performance are more important.
Final Thoughts
Slow website infrastructure is not only an IT problem.
It affects how visitors perceive the business, how efficiently marketing budgets work and how reliably the website generates leads or sales.
The website may remain online while losing opportunities through delays, uncertainty and inconsistent performance.
These losses are difficult to see individually, but they accumulate.
Businesses that depend on their websites should treat infrastructure as part of commercial operations. Reliable hosting does not create demand by itself, but it ensures the website is ready to support the demand that marketing, content and reputation have already created.
